Aviation Electronics, Electrical & Computer Systems Technician (Aviation Electrician's Mate / Aviation Electronics Technician) - Full Time
Technical support engineer job in Charleston, SC
About Aviation Electronics, Electrical, and Computer Systems Technicians (AV) work with some of the most advanced aircraft systems in the world. They repair and maintain electrical and electronic systems ranging from radar and communications to navigation and weapon systems. AV Sailors may also volunteer as Naval Aircrewmen, performing in-flight duties and operating radar and weapon systems.
Responsibilities
Depending on your rating (AE or AT), you may:
Troubleshoot and repair complex aircraft systems, including digital computers, fiber optics, infrared detection, radar, and laser electronics.
Maintain electrical power generation and distribution systems.
Test and calibrate aircraft instruments and automatic flight controls.
Perform micro-miniature module repair on circuit cards.
Install modifications to aircraft electronics systems.
Operate diagnostic equipment and read electrical diagrams.
Work Environment
AV technicians serve at sea and ashore worldwide. Work may be performed in hangars, onboard aircraft carriers, in labs, or outdoors on flight lines. Youll work closely with other technicians, often with minimal supervision, in both technical and operational settings.
Training & Advancement
Class A Technical School Pensacola, FL (1826 weeks) Covers aviation theory, electrical systems, electronics theory, and technical skills. After training, Sailors are assigned to AE or AT
ratings and may serve at naval air stations, squadrons, or aboard carriers. Advanced training is available for specific aircraft and systems.

AOC Network Administration Support I
Technical support engineer job in Sumter, SC
MicroTech is seeking an Air Operations Command (AOC) Network Administrator Level I for the Combined Air Operations Center (CAOC) at Shaw AFB, South Carolina. The CAOC team provides installation, operation, maintenance, administration and management of AOC Weapons System network infrastructure, datalinks and systems to ensure services are operational and available with minimal interruption. This includes the switches, routers, encryption devices, cabling and other equipment providing connectivity supported by 609 ACOMS and 609 EACOMS.
Responsibilities
· Provide Tier 2 technical support (diagnosis, analysis and troubleshooting and resolution for more complex network, client and end-user connectivity issues escalated by Tier 1 technical support staff);
· Add and remove client devices (e.g., PCs, Thin Clients, VoIPs, VoSIPs, VTCs, DVTCs, peripherals, etc.) from networks.
· Update and patch network equipment, firmware and software to ensure configuration and cybersecurity compliance.
· Operate and maintain access control systems; and manage and configure MAC address authentication.
· Administer network administrative accounts and access.
· Operate and maintain network monitoring and analysis tools; and detect, analyze and resolve network infrastructure and systems problems.
· Monitor and control network performance, utilization and capacity to ensure optimal performance, availability, serviceability and recoverability; and report any vulnerabilities or deficiencies to 609 ACOMS and 609 EACOMS government technical representatives.
· Evaluate current infrastructure, research current technologies/solutions; and provide hardware/software upgrade and replacement recommendations for end-of-life/end-of- support COTS products to 609 ACOMS and 609 EACOMS government technical representatives.
